The Channel Islands of Jersey and Guernsey were quick to recognise that the alternative investment fund managers directive (AIFMD), introduced in the European Union in 2013, might be good for business. It would give them an opportunity to bolster their attractiveness as a base for alternative investment funds. The impact of MAR in the Channel Islands is mitigated by the fact that Guernsey and Jersey are not within the EU and therefore MAR does not have effect in the Islands; consequently MAR does not apply to listings on the Channel Islands Securities Exchange (CISE), significantly reducing administrative burden compared to listings on European markets subject to MAR.
